Bellevue Public Library Adult Displays for March





Every month there are special adult displays at BPL– some are new displays and some are new books in ongoing displays. These displays are located on the black tower, on the front and back of the arch going into the adult reading area, on a bookshelf at the far end of the circulation desk, and at the information/reference desk area.. All titles are available for check-out.

Often the displays are based on special events, programs or themes. Sometimes the display topics are suggested by staff, but we also welcome suggestions from patrons!

Current permanent displays with moving titles include New Large Print, Next to New (books that have just left the new fiction and nonfiction areas), and Adult Graphic Novels.
This month’s new displays include titles about Famous Women in History (Women’s History Month), Everything Irish ( Irish-American Heritage Month - St. Patrick’s Day), Piece Together a Good Read (fiction on quilting, knitting, stitchery, and scrapbooking- National Craft Month), Nebraska Authors, Movies (DVD’s) based on writings by Nebraska authors (Nebraska Statehood March 1), and Survival Stories.
If you are in a hurry, these displays can help you find a great read without searching  the stacks.
The titles might be in a favorite genre or introduce you to a new author you might enjoy!
